REPLACEMENT
OF
PARTS
AND
READJUSTMENTS
|
Stylus
replacement
(U.K.
model
only)
The
stylus
tip
life
of
the
attached
cartridge
is
ap-
proximately
500
hours.
Earlier
replacement
of
the
stylus
is
recommended,
as
a
worn
stylus
tip
may
cause
distorted
sounds
and
damage
to
the
records.
Be
sure
to
ask
for
‘“‘DENON
DSN-80”
when
purchasing
a
replacement
stylus.
There
will
be
no
guarantee
on
the
performance
and
against
malfunctions
if
a
different
stylus
is
used.
How
to
replace
1.
Loosen
the
lock
screw
on
the
foremost
end
of
the
tonearm,
and
pull
the
head
shell
out
in
the
direction
of
the
arrow.
2.
Remove
four
lead
wires
located
at
the
back
edge
of
the
cartridge.
3.
Holding
the
both
sides
of
the
stylus
cover
with
your
fingers,
pull
it
out
in
the
direction
of
the
arrow
in
the
figure.
At
this
time,
the
terminals
are
also
removed.
4.
Attach
a
new
replacement
stylus
to
the
car-
tridge
until
it
is
locked.
5.
Connect
the
lead
wires
to
the
terminal.
See
the
“Cartridge
Replacement”
for
the
con-
nection.
Cartridge
replacement
A
different
cartridge
with
a
weight
between
3
and
12g
(including
screws
and
nuts)
can
be
attached
to
the
head
shell
of
this
turntable
unit.
(When
pur-
chasing
only
the
head
shell,
ask
for
the
“DENON
PCL-40"")
The
overhang
of
this
turntable
unit
is
16
mm.
When
the
installation
is
performed
as
shown
in
the
diagram,
the
proper
overhang
is
obtained.
Note:
When
the
cartridge
has
been
replaced,
be
sure
to
readjust
the
horizontal
balance,
tracking
force
and
OQ-damping.
The
color
designation
of
the
lead
wires
is
as
follows.
Be
careful
not
to
make
any
errors.
Red
,.........
right
channel
(R)
White.........
left
channel
(L)
Green.........
right
channel
ground
(RG)
Blue
,..........
left
channel
ground
(LG)
How
to
raise
the
stylus
cover
(For
attached
cartridge
DL-80
or
DL-160)
To
protect
the
stylus
tip,
lower
the
stylus
cover
after
use.
